How You Will Make An Impact You will be responsible for delivering and serving food and beverages at scheduled functions. As a Catering Server, You Will Assemble and deliver all food and supplies for catered functions to their scheduled locations Log and maintain food temperatures Assist with food and table prep before events begin Arrange buffet tables with food, beverage, and service items according to standards Serve plated dinners to guests and respond to requests for beverages, appetizers, and other needs Keep display equipment clean and free of debris during meal service Thoroughly clean location after event is completed and assist with inventory, food storage and other closeout tasks Return food and beverages, serving equipment and utensils to catering facility Stock, clean and maintain catering facility and equipment Ensure guests receive friendly, courteous service at all times Maintain in-depth knowledge of the complete menu and products on hand Maintain clean and safe work environment Follow safety and sanitation policy and procedures at all times May drive a catering delivery truck About You You must have a valid Food Handler Certificate or provincial equivalent and Responsible Beverage Service Certificate for the province in which you are applying Minimum 1 year experience in a similar environment Valid driver’s license may be required Able to accurately read event orders and organize deliveries for the day Ability to remain calm under pressure while working in a fast-paced environment Strong oral and written communication skills Extremely well organized and efficient; able to multi-task Good attention to detail Physical ability to carry out the duties of the position “ What’s in it for you?
